| Background of the target antigen | Appears to act as a metabolic stress-sensing protein kinase switching off biosynthetic pathways when cellular ATP levels are depleted and when 5'-AMP rises in response to fuel limitation and/or hypoxia, It also regulates cholesterol synthesis via phosphorylation and inactivation of hormone-sensitive lipase and hydroxymethylglutaryl-CoA reductase, This is a catalytic subunit, Responsible for the regulation of fatty acid synthesis by phosphorylation of acetyl-CoA carboxylase |
